Warning: Contains spoilers for Fear the Walking Dead season 4's mid-season finale 'No One's Gone', which aired last night (June 10) in the US.

AMC's sister zombie show Fear the Walking Dead has just cut for its mid-season four break. The finale supplied viewers with tear-inducing drama, leaving them thirsty for more, but now we know when it'll officially continue.

It's now been announced that the the show will return for the second half of season four on Monday, August 12 at 2am in the UK - simultaneous with the US premiere on Sunday, August 12 at 9pm ET/PT. The show airs on AMC on both sides of the pond, with AMC UK being exclusive to BT customers.

In the UK, we'll also get a 9pm repeat on the same day if you just can't stay up until 2am on a Monday morning.

The second half of season four will deal with the aftermath of Madison's death, which audience's experienced in last night's (June 10) pulse-raising episode.

Kim Dickens, who portrayed Madison Clark, recently felt that this role was in the 'career defining' category, but appreciated her time on the show.

Opening up about her character's shocking but thrilling exit, the actress noted: "It's so sad. Madison has been an incredible character to play. I feel like I worked my whole career to get to this point to play her. It's been an honour."

With Madison's maternal path creating a unique feeling for Dickens, she elaborated: "As Kim the actor, I thought, I feel I would cry during this scene but you realise the mother in this scene would impart through subtext, 'I'm OK, don't worry about me. I'm OK, I love you'.

"I think that's what Madison [conveyed] across the lines. She was strong for her daughter."
